Why does Mohr-Coulomb fail criterion?

When the soil sample has failed, the shear stress on the failure plane defines the shear strength of the soil. Thus, it is necessary to identify the failure plane. A line tangential to the Mohr circles can be drawn, and is called the Mohr-Coulomb failure envelope.

What is the Coulomb failure criterion?

Coulomb failure criterion The simplest relationship between shear stress (τ) acting parallel to a plane and normal stress (σ) acting perpendicular to the plane at the point of failure.

What do you mean by shear strength of soil discuss Mohr-Coulomb failure theory?

Mohr–Coulomb theory is a mathematical model (see yield surface) describing the response of brittle materials such as concrete, or rubble piles, to shear stress as well as normal stress. In geotechnical engineering it is used to define shear strength of soils and rocks at different effective stresses.

What is the Coulomb failure envelope?

The Mohr-Coulomb failure envelope is a constitutive model suitable for describing the strength of many soils, intact rock, and rock masses. What is Mohr Coulomb plasticity?

The Mohr-Coulomb plasticity model can be used with any stress/displacement elements other than one-dimensional elements (beam, pipe, and truss elements) or elements for which the assumed stress state is plane stress (plane stress, shell, and membrane elements).

What is modified Mohr-Coulomb theory?

The Modified Mohr-Coulomb model is an advanced material model that can simulate the behavior of different types of soil. The Modified Mohr-Coulomb model combines power-law nonlinear elastic behavior, with exponential cap-hardening with Rowe’s dilatancy rule.

What is Mohr’s strength theory?

The Mohr theory is virtually an empirical theory of yield which accounts for the behavior of permanently deformed materials. As portrayed on a Mohr stress diagram the theory assumes a functional relation between mean stress and maximum shear stress on the plane of failure.

What does the Mohr Coulomb envelope represent?

The Mohr envelope is primarily a graphic method of representing the results of a series of experiments on failure of rocks or soils under varying external conditions—e.g., triaxial tests at a series of confining pressures.

How do you calculate Mohr Coulomb?

Indeed, a large number of the routine design calculations in the geotechnical area are still performed using the Mohr-Coulomb criterion. τ=c−σtanϕ, τ = c – σ ⁢ ⁡ where τ is the shear stress, σ is the normal stress (negative in compression), c is the cohesion of the material, and ϕ is the material angle of friction.

Is Mohr Coulomb plasticity used in geotechnical applications?

Mohr-Coulomb plasticity. The Mohr-Coulomb failure or strength criterion has been widely used for geotechnical applications. Indeed, a large number of the routine design calculations in the geotechnical area are still performed using the Mohr-Coulomb criterion.

What is Abaqus Mohr Coulomb model?

Mohr-Coulomb model. The Abaqus Mohr-Coulomb plasticity model uses the classical Mohr-Coulomb yield function, which includes isotropic cohesion hardening and softening. It also uses a smooth flow potential that has a hyperbolic shape in the meridional stress plane and a piecewise elliptic shape in the deviatoric stress plane.
